Output e676236363039cd5952f7e9e5d3b4633f1041857fa6b5f0f980b96a427e6f9d9:1

value
1403598
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d388d434d8bec6b0b8663aba793795db205f477 OP_EQUALVERIFY OP_CHECKSIG
address
1Ki7Gcbg5aPjGzWwN8xNsr5Ey3RNJVSmxc
transaction
e676236363039cd5952f7e9e5d3b4633f1041857fa6b5f0f980b96a427e6f9d9
spent
true